Rocca Aldobrandesca (Il Sasso)
Italy, Italy
Rocca Aldobrandesca, commonly known as Il Sasso, is a medieval fortress ruin that towers above the village of Roccalbegna in southern Tuscany.
Built by the powerful Aldobrandeschi family, it occupies the summit of a dramatic rock outcrop overlooking the Albegna Valley, a position that made it an excellent defensive stronghold and lookout point. During the Middle Ages, the fortress played a key role in protecting the settlement and served as a refuge for residents during times of conflict.
Its elevated location made it extremely difficult to attack, and together with nearby fortifications it formed the core of Roccalbegna’s defensive system. Although now in ruins, substantial sections of its stone walls remain, creating a striking landmark above the village. Visitors are drawn to the site for its historical significance, dramatic setting, and panoramic views across the surrounding hills and valleys of Tuscany.
